GRAMMY’S CHICKEN ‘n STUFFING CASSEROLE

Ingredients:

For the Chicken:

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il

For the Stuffing:

  • 1 package (about 8 oz) herb-seasoned stuffing mix
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ter
  • 1 cup celery, finely chopped
  • 1 cup onion, finely chopped
  • 1 cup chicken broth

For the Casserole:

  • 1 can (10.5 oz) cream of chicken soup
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 1 cup frozen peas
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)

Instructions:

  1. Preheat and Prep:
    •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
    • Season chicken breasts with salt, p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, and dried thyme.
  2. Sear the Chicken:
    • In an oven-safe sk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at.
    • Sear chicken breasts on both sides until golden brown, about 3-4 minutes per side. Remove from the skillet and set aside.
  3. Prepare the Stuffing:
    • In the same skillet, melt butter. Add chopped celery and onions, sautéing until softened.
    • Stir in the stuffing mix and chicken broth. Combine until the stuffing is well-coated.
  4. Layer the Casserole:
    • Arrange seared chicken breasts on top of the stuffing in the skillet.
  5. Create the Casserole Mix:
    • In a bowl, mix cream of chicken soup and sour cream until well combined.
    • Pour the mixture over the chicken and stuffing in the skillet.
  6. Add Vegetables and Cheese:
    • Sprinkle frozen peas evenly over the casserole.
    • Top with shredded cheddar cheese for a gooey, golden finish.
  7. Bake to Perfection:
    • Transfer the skillet to the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es or until the chicken is cooked through and the casserole is bubbly.
  8. Garnish and Serve:
    • Sprinkle chopped fresh parsley over the casserole for a burst of color and freshness.
    • Allow it to cool for a few minutes before serving.

Cook Notes:

  • If you don’t have an oven-safe skillet, transfer the mixture to a baking dish before baking.

Variations:

Flavorful Additions to the Chicken:

  1. Bacon Bliss: Elevate the richness with crispy bacon bits. Cook separately and stir them in before baking.
  2. Sun-Dried Tomato Sophistication: Add chopped sun-dried tomatoes for a burst of concentrated flavor.
  3. Mushroom Magic: Include sautéed mushrooms for an earthy depth.
